Upcoming Festival: Texas Community Music Festival @ Central Market North, April 15-24

The 2016 Texas Community Music Festival rides again at Central Market North! The event runs from Friday, April 15 through Sunday, April 24, featuring a huge number of local bands and artists and a wide array of musical genres. This copy is from the TCMF About page

The Texas Community Music Festival kicked off in Austin April 29, 2006, at Central Market North, and drew approximately 10,000 over the four days to the central Austin location, far exceeding expectations, and setting the stage for what has now become a Central Texas tradition.

Over the years, the performances at TCMF have run the musical gamut, from traditional bierhaus music to full-sized orchestras; from Middle Eastern Bellydancers to Scottish pipe and drums to “All That Jazz.” We’ve even had a few “zombie invasions!” Musicians ranging in age from 9 to well past 90.

If the music lives in Texas, the music’s been performed LIVE at the Texas Community Music Festival.

For 2016, the festival celebrates its eleventh anniversary! Stay tuned, and check back. As the world moves into the new age, so will Live Music in Texas. And you’ll find all of it right here, at the Texas Community Music Festival!

TCMF is organized, managed and promoted by the Austin Civic Wind Ensemble, Austin’s oldest community band, and has been generously hosted over the years by Central Market North. Past hosts have also included the Park at The Triangle and Scholz Garten.
